Netsmart Vs Solismed: The Best EMR Choice for your Practice in 2022
Netsmart EHR is an ARRA-Certified EHR and practice management solution that is fully integrated and intended to meet the unique demands of local medical offices. The software incorporates a Windows-based architecture into an intuitive solution that is user-friendly, simple to learn, and easy to teach. The software solution is ideal for medical practices of all sizes and supports a wide range of health programmes, including case management, vaccines, infectious illnesses, family and child health services, and many more. Solismed is a high-performance practise management system for clinics, wellness centres, rehabilitation facilities, nursing homes, and small hospitals. The same system includes appointment scheduling, patient care management, e-prescribing, electronic health records, inventory control, billing, and a patient portal. Solismed is excellent for multitasking (for example, opening numerous patient visits) and teamwork (such as accessing the same patient records on an exam room computer). Have complete control over your patient data and do not share it with anybody, unlike when you subscribe to a service that sells or manipulates your patient data for financial gain.
Netsmart EHR
Public health organizations are served by Netsmart Insight’s cloud-based practice management and electronic health record (EHR) system, whose key features include financial reporting, operational management, and case management, among others. In addition, they assist with administrative activities such as schedule management, dashboard access to patient information, order administration, providing a safe and confidential system, and complying to the Public Health Informatics Institute’s guidelines. In addition, their financial reporting solution facilitates customer access to claim management, payer information, accounting, and billing services.

Solismed EHR
Solismed is an all-inclusive, adaptable, and configurable practice management system. It includes capabilities such as patient care management, electronic health records, inventory control, billing, and team collaboration. It can also be self-hosted and offers the highest degree of dependability and data security. It is an effective solution for small to medium-sized practices and community organizations. This open-source clinic management system is free for up to five users, but a premium license is required. Solismed EHR can be deployed for free in clinics with fewer than five users, but it is not a cost-effective alternative for bigger clinics. After that, it will cost approximately $500 per person to continue using it for your whole practice. Additionally, upgrades are available at a discount.

Solismed EHR Pricing
Solismed provides a free trial. Following the free trial, three pricing tiers are available. The Basic package begins at $49 per month, while the Professional and Enterprise plans begin at $99 and $199 per month, respectively. In addition, there is a one-time setup cost of $199.
